The Lip Filler Procedure
Before we answer questions on how long lip fillers take to settle, let’s first discuss what happens during a lip injection procedure.
Basically, lip fillers have 3 phases – pre-treatment, the actual lip injection session, and post-treatment. It is important to follow your specialist’s advice and tips for each phase, as this will determine the success of your procedure.
Pre-Treatment Care
Consultation
Before anything else, you will need to have a one-on-one consultation with your lip injector. Once you have a clinic of choice, a specialist will be assigned to you for the consultation. Here, you’ll have to discuss your goals and expectations for the lip filler treatment you’ll be getting.

Assessment
After your initial consultation, an assessment will be the next step. Here, our lip injector will show you exactly where and how many injections you will be getting based on your facial structure and the symmetry of your lips. It’s important to openly discuss your preference on how plump you want your lips to be, as well as the areas where you want more volume.
Preparation Before the Procedure
Here are a few things to note before your actual lip injection session.
- Avoid medications such as Ibuprofen and Aspirin. These are blood thinners and can cause bleeding.
- If you need pain medication before your filler treatment, opt to use Tylenol instead.
- Avoid supplements with Omega-3, garlic, ginger, and Vitamin E.
- Avoid shaving, waxing, threading, or plucking hair around your lips.
- A few days before your scheduled appointment, stop using skin care products with exfoliating agents.
- On the day of your appointment, do not put any makeup or skincare products on.
During the Lip Injection Procedure
After thorough preparation, finally, your scheduled appointment comes. Although our specialist will discuss what happens during this procedure, to give you a glimpse, here’s what’s going to happen:
- Our injector will apply a topical numbing cream to ease your discomfort during the procedure.
- Your lip area will be disinfected and will be lined or prepped before the actual injection.
- During the injections, our specialist will cover all the areas you specifically want to augment. This will last for approximately 20 to 30 minutes only, and you should expect to feel a pinching sensation each time an area is injected with fillers.
- After the procedure, our esthetician will gently massage your lips to help the fillers settle in.

What to Expect After Lip Injections?
You won’t see instant results after having fillers injected. You will see the parts where it was augmented however it would be accompanied by swelling.
Apart from the common swelling and bruising, you may feel some sensitivity and tenderness on your lips as well. This is normal after having lip injections and will typically subside within a week’s time.
If you have any issues regarding your lips seeming asymmetrical, don’t worry. It’s normal until your fillers reach their 4th week when they settle in completely. Touch-ups, if needed, will be done in the correct phase.

When Will I See My Lip Filler Results?
On average, it takes about 4 weeks until lip fillers completely settle in and bind with your soft tissues. By this time, you will have another appointment with your specialist for an assessment of lip symmetry and size.
If you wish to make any adjustments or have more filler injections, it will be done during this phase. For any corrections on lip symmetry, you will also have to wait until this phase before your specialist can make the necessary adjustments.

How Long Do Lip Fillers Last?
Since lip injections are made from natural ingredients and substances, they are biodegradable. Getting lip fillers is not permanent and results are reversible. Your body will eventually break down these ingredients over time and your lips will go back to their natural state.
It takes about 6 to 12 months for lip fillers to have completely degenerated from your body. The rate it goes depends on your body’s metabolism. Longevity varies from one patient to another as bodies are unique and there is no definite time to know how long before your filler is broken down.
